2025/12/25 13:58:14
网站建设
项目流程
外贸网站的推广,wordpress最好的编辑器下载地址,网页塔防游戏排行榜,成都工装装修设计公司快速体验
打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容#xff1a; 创建一个chmod效率对比工具#xff0c;功能包括#xff1a;1) 自动统计手动修改多层目录权限所需时间 2) 测量使用chmod -R的耗时 3) 生成效率对比图表 4) 提供批量权限修改建议 …快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容创建一个chmod效率对比工具功能包括1) 自动统计手动修改多层目录权限所需时间 2) 测量使用chmod -R的耗时 3) 生成效率对比图表 4) 提供批量权限修改建议 5) 记录历史操作节省的总时间。使用Python实现包含可视化图表展示支持导出效率报告。点击项目生成按钮等待项目生成完整后预览效果最近在服务器维护时经常需要批量修改文件权限。手动一个个改不仅费时费力还容易出错。于是我开发了一个小工具来对比chmod手动操作和递归操作的效率差异结果发现合理使用参数能节省大量时间。为什么需要关注chmod效率在Linux系统中文件权限管理是日常运维的基础操作。当目录结构复杂、文件数量多时手动执行chmod命令会消耗大量时间。比如修改一个包含1000个文件的目录权限手动操作可能需要10分钟而使用chmod -R只需几秒钟。工具实现思路我使用Python开发了这个效率对比工具主要功能包括自动创建测试目录结构包含多层子目录和文件分别统计手动遍历修改权限和使用chmod -R命令的耗时生成直观的效率对比图表记录历史操作并计算节省的总时间关键功能实现使用os.walk()遍历目录树模拟手动操作通过subprocess调用系统chmod命令用time模块精确测量执行时间借助matplotlib绘制对比柱状图将结果保存为CSV报告实测数据对比测试一个包含5层目录、500个文件的场景手动修改耗时142秒使用chmod -R耗时0.8秒 效率提升超过170倍随着文件数量增加这个差距会更大。使用建议批量操作一定要用-R参数谨慎设置权限值递归操作影响范围大可以先在测试目录验证重要操作前建议备份工具使用体验这个工具帮我养成了使用递归参数的习惯。现在处理权限问题时我都会先评估是否需要批量操作节省的时间可以投入其他更重要的工作。如果你也想体验高效的文件权限管理可以试试InsCode(快马)平台。它的在线环境能快速运行这类效率工具不用配置本地环境特别方便。实际使用时发现修改完代码点一下就能看到效果对日常运维工作帮助很大。特别是部署功能很实用像这种持续运行的服务类程序一键就能发布到线上省去了服务器配置的麻烦。对于需要长期运行的运维监控工具特别合适。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容创建一个chmod效率对比工具功能包括1) 自动统计手动修改多层目录权限所需时间 2) 测量使用chmod -R的耗时 3) 生成效率对比图表 4) 提供批量权限修改建议 5) 记录历史操作节省的总时间。使用Python实现包含可视化图表展示支持导出效率报告。点击项目生成按钮等待项目生成完整后预览效果创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考